To understand the gravity of Episode 61, we must set the stage. The show, centered around the prestigious St. Mary’s College and the band Fab 5 (later Pulse ), follows the volatile relationship between the rich, rebellious guitarist (Parth Samthaan) and the shy, talented photographer Nandini Murthy (Niti Taylor).
